A Broad spectrum Antiphage Strain Constituted with Protoplast Fusion Technology

  • Antiphage mutants selected by 15 phage strains have resistant only to its relevant phage,50it is narrow-spectrum antiphage strain.The fusant ZG88 is obtained with protoplast fusion be-tween Corynebacterium pekinense 7338 and Corynebacterium crenatum Ts-Li.It s serologic reac-tion and phage attach test show that it has changed so much in cell surface structures as to losethe position of adsorption.So ZG 88 is a broad spectrum and steady antiphage strain.
